COOPERATIVE EDUCATION TRAINING PROGRAM. The purpose is to establish the salary rate and working conditions for students hired under the Cooperative Education Training Program. (a) Employees hired under the Cooperative Education Training Program will be considered auxiliary employees and receive the appropriate benefits as per this agreement. (b) The program will be restricted to persons registered in a recognized cooperative education program at a participating post-secondary institution. The length of appointment for students under this article will correspond to the requirements of their academic program. (c) Coop education will be considered supernumerary to the established workforce. As such, Clause 31.5(d) will apply to these programs. (d) No employees hired under this program will be employed where it would result in a layoff or failure to recall a qualified employee. (e) Employees hired under this program will be classified and paid in accordance with Appendix 1D at Level 1 or 2 as appropriate. (f) The standard hours of work for employees under this program will be seven hours per day and 35 hours per week. (g) The standard hours of work may be varied by mutual agreement at the local level, consistent with local hours of work agreements, provided that no employee works more than 10 hours in one day and 70 hours in a biweekly period. (h) Employees hired under the Cooperative Education Training Program shall be assigned work that augments their field of study.
